The Mexico Bulldogs Boys Basketball Team will travel to Kearney for the 1st round of the Sectional playoffs tonight (Tuesday).

Mexico comes into the game with a record of 21-3, Kearney is 13-8.

Tipoff is at 6pm.

The first ever appearance for a Mexico High School Girl Wrestler at the State Tournament will take place this morning (Tuesday).

The competition starts at 9:30 this morning (Tuesday) in Independence, Missouri at the Cable Dahmer Arena.

Mexico’s Katie Bowen will be representing the Bulldogs at the State Tournament and will be one of the first matches up.

The matches will be available at mshaa.tv.

The St. Louis Blues lost 3-2 in overtime to the San Jose Sharks on the road last night (Monday).

Vladimir Tarasenko had an assist for the Blues in his second game of the season.

He missed the first 24 games after having surgery on his left shoulder.

St. Louis returns home on Friday when they face the Vegas Golden Knights.
